
A THUG stuck his thumbs into his girlfriend’s eyes, strangled and threatened her with a knife after she tried to break up with him.
Vile Layton Bowman, 20, brutally attacked his victim and left her fearing for her life on May 10 earlier this year.
The abuser strangled and threatened her with a knife when she told him she wanted to end their relationship.
Police arrested Bowman the following day after the brave victim came forward.
Officers also found cannabis in his possession and Bowman was detained.
Sergeant Mick Johnson, from our Stoke-on-Trent north local policing team, said: “I am delighted that we were able to secure evidence against Bowman and convict him for his offending.
“I would like to commend the bravery of the survivor in this case for coming forward and assisting us with our investigation.
“I hope this conviction shows that we are committed to taking robust action against those who commit violence crimes in Stoke-on-Trent and wider Staffordshire.”
